Here's an excerpt from the C3D 2013 Readme:
**********************************
COM Interop Changes
Interop DLLs are no longer registered as Primary Interop Assemblies (PIAs), and are deployed in the AutoCAD Civil 3D installation folder rather than the Global Assembly Cache (GAC). This means that these assemblies must now be added to Visual Studio projects using the Browse tab of the Add Reference dialog box, rather than from the COM tab as was done previously.
To compile previously written projects against AutoCAD Civil 3D 2013, you will need to remove references to all interop assemblies from your project, and then re-add them using the Browse tab.
The assemblies required for COM interop are:
•Autodesk.AEC.Interop.Base
•Autodesk.AEC.Interop.UiBase
•Autodesk.AutoCAD.Interop
•Autodesk.AutoCAD.Interop.Common
•Autodesk.AECC.Interop.<domain>
•Autodesk.AECC.Interop.Ui<domain>
**********************************
These 6 interop assemblies are referenced in the CSharpClientSample app. Remove them and re-reference using the Browse tab (C3D installation folder). The runtime version for each is 4.0.xxxxx. On my machine it's 4.0.30319. Also, on my machine, none of these assemblies are in th GAC.
.NET 4.0 allows com assemblies to be embeded in the .NET application. Therefore the Embed Interop Types property should be set to True.

Thanks, Tom. I have followed those instruction to the letter, and it works fine on a 64 bit install when the dll is also built on a 64 bit machine. But it fails to work on a 32 bit install. I can take the same exact project, copy it to the 32 bit machine, rebuild it, and it works fine in the 32 bit C3D. But take THAT dll to a 64 bit machine and it fails in the exact same manner. Leading me to think we now need 2 separate builds for 32 & 64 bit machines....which is not what I wanted to hear.
For anyone wanting to check this out, I've attached a VS2010 C# project which demonstrates this issue. Built in Win7x64 it runs fine in C3D2013x64. Copy this dll to a 32bit machine and run C3D2013 there, it fails. Copy the project to the 32bit machine, open in VS, rebuild, run C3D2013 and the command runs fine. Copy that dll to the x64 machine, run in C3D, failure.
This is the all that I have executing in this test:
public class Class1 { [CommandMethod("COMTest")] public void conmtest() { Editor ed = Application.DocumentManager.MdiActiveDocument.Editor; ed.WriteMessage("\nAttempting to set AcadApplication object...."); try { AcadApplication acadapp = (AcadApplication)Application.AcadApplication; ed.WriteMessage("\n....Success!"); } catch (System.Exception e) { ed.WriteMessage("\n.....FAILED! \n" + e.Message); } } }
